Address

bc1pyju2r4sr2aarw4j9s5srnhee3yvlc37ezft8x2rrnx276zx50lhq28l76d
Confirmed tx count
396
Confirmed received
508 outputs (5.85549896 BTC)
Confirmed spent
405 outputs (5.85465563 BTC)
Confirmed unspent
103 outputs (0.00084333 BTC)

25 of 396 Transactions